أنت غير متصل حاليًا، وفي انتظار الإنترنت الخاص بك ليقوم بإعادة الاتصال

Setsockopt غير قادر على وضع علامة على نوع "بروتوكول إنترنت" بتات الخدمة في رأس الحزمة "بروتوكول إنترنت"

انتهاء دعم نظام التشغيل Windows XP

لقد أنهت شركة Microsoft دعم Windows XP في 8 أبريل، 2014. وقد أثر هذا التغيير على تحديثات البرامج لديك وخيارات الأمان الخاصة بك. تعرف على ما يعنيه ذلك فيما يتعلق بك وكيفية الحفاظ على حمايتك.

انتهي دعم Windows Server 2003 في 14 يوليو 2015!

أنهت شركة Microsoft دعم نظام التشغيل Windows Server 2003 في 14 يوليو 2015. لقد أثر هذا التغيير على تحديثات البرامج لديك وخيارات الأمان الخاصة بك. تعرف على ما يعنيه ذلك فيما يتعلق بك وكيفية الحفاظ على حمايتك.

هام: تمت ترجمة هذا المقال باستخدام برنامج ترجمة آلية لشركة مايكروسوفت بدلاً من الاستعانة بمترجم بشري. تقدم شركة مايكروسوفت كلاً من المقالات المترجمة بواسطة المترجمين البشر والمقالات المترجمة آليًا وبالتالي ستتمكن من الوصول إلى كل المقالات الموجودة في قاعدة المعرفة الخاصة بنا وباللغة الخاصة بك. بالرغم من ذلك، فإن المقالة المترجمة آليًا لا تكون دقيقة دائمًا وقد تحتوي على أخطاء إملائية أو لغوية أو نحوية، مثل تلك الأخطاء الصادرة عن متحدث أجنبي عندما يتحدث بلغتك. لا تتحمل شركة مايكروسوفت مسئولية عدم الدقة أو الأخطاء أو الضرر الناتج عن أية أخطاء في ترجمة المحتوى أو استخدامه من قبل عملائنا. تعمل شركة مايكروسوفت باستمرار على ترقية برنامج الترجمة الآلية

اضغط هنا لرابط المقالة باللغة الانجليزية248611
الموجز
نظام التشغيل Microsoft Windows 2000 و Windows XP نظام التشغيل Windows Server 2003 لا يدعم وضع علامة على وحدات بت بروتوكول إنترنت (IP) "نوع الخدمة" (ToS) مع الدالة setsockopt.
معلومات أخرى
على Windows NT 4.0 و Windows 9 x Winsock تطبيقات يمكن تعيين بت ToS في رأس IP حزم UDP و ICMP بواسطة استدعاء دالة setsockopt مع الخيار IP_TOS. تسمح الأداة المساعدة ping على تلك الأنظمة الأساسية أيضاً بت ToS وضع علامة في حزم echo ICMP باستخدام "-v" الخيار. الرجاء ملاحظة أن بت ToS وضع علامة حزم TCP لم يكن أبداً المتوفرة Winsock حتى بالرغم من أن استدعاء setsockopt مع الخيار IP_TOS على مآخذ TCP بإرجاع 0 (نجاح).

يتم تعطيل وحدات بت ToS وضع علامة الوظائف في تطبيقات Winsock والأداة المساعدة ping على Windows 2000 و Windows XP و Windows Server 2003 بشكل افتراضي. محاولة تعيين خيار IP_TOS مع الدالة setsockopt على هذه الإصدارات من Microsoft Windows لا يزال بإرجاع 0 (نجاح) للسماح للتطبيقات متابعة تشغيل; ولكن لم يتم وضع علامة بت ToS في رأس IP.

تغيير تصميم هذه لأنه ToS السابقة "و" بتات الأسبقية المحدد في طلب عن التعليقات (RFC) 1349 قد أصبحت قديمة بظهور 2474 RFCs و 2475. استبدال هذه RFCs ToS "خدمات التمييز ما بين بأكثر بتقسيمها" (DiffServ).

نقطة رمز DiffServ (DSCP) يتيح الحزم بالمرور عبر أجهزة شبكة الاتصال التشغيل الطبقة 3 المعلومات، مثل أجهزة التوجيه لجعل أولويات النسبية الخاصة بهم التمييز ما بين بأكثر بتقسيمها عن بعضها البعض. يتم تأسيس DSCP عن طريق إعداد بت الستة الأولى من الحقل ToS في رأس IP. تم افتراض الدالة لتحديد أسبقية IP DSCP ولكن يحتفظ بالتوافق مع الإصدارات السابقة. يمكن إنشاء قوائم الانتظار المستندة إلى الأسبقية مجمعة وقم بتوفير أفضل خدمة للحزم التي لها أولوية نسبية أعلى أجهزة الطبقة 3 مع وضع علامة "DSCP.

يكون هذا مفيدًا بشكل خاص عندما خدمات الحزم عرضة قوائم انتظار ، كما الحال ضمن التحميلات حركة مرور شبكة الاتصال الهامة المقترنة دفق الوسائط العروض التقديمية "و" أخرى تدفقات بيانات الوقت الحقيقي. بالنسبة DSCP لتكون فاعلية يجب أن تكون أجهزة الطبقة 3 تمكين DSCP.

على أجهزة مضيف يعمل بنظام التشغيل Windows 2000 أو بنظام التشغيل Windows XP أو المستندة إلى Windows Server 2003 تطبيق عام جودة من الخدمة (GQOS) يحدد وضع علامة DSCP. تشغل برنامج GQOS Winsock موفر خدمة RSVP لإرسال النهج ثم يتحقق الموارد لتحديد إتاحة الموارد طول مسار بيانات شبكة والتحكم النهج. إذا تمت الموافقة على استخدام المورد المحدد علامات خدمة "جدولة حزم QOS الأولويات DSCP في رؤوس الحزم IP. تجاوز Windows 2000 أو Windows XP أو Windows Server 2003 QOS نهج التحكم الخيار IP_TOS مع الدالة setsockopt ثم تم تعطيلها بشكل افتراضي على هذه الإصدارات من Windows.

توصي Microsoft بتطبيق GQOS في برامج Winsock الاستفادة من قدرات Windows 2000 و Windows XP و Windows Server 2003 GQOS. ومع ذلك، للسماح السلوك مشابهاً Windows NT 4.0 IP_TOS على Windows 2000 أو Windows XP أو Windows Server 2003 من أجل التوافق مع الإصدارات السابقة, مفتاح تسجيل جديد تم إضافة.

هام هذا المقطع أو أسلوب أو المهمة على خطوات إخبارك عن كيفية تعديل التسجيل. ومع ذلك، قد تحدث مشكلات خطيرة في حالة تعديل السجل بطريقة غير صحيحة. لذلك، تأكد من اتبع الخطوات التالية بعناية. للحصول على الحماية المضافة عمل نسخة احتياطية من السجل قبل تعديله. ثم يمكنك استعادة السجل في حالة حدوث مشكلة. للحصول على مزيد من المعلومات حول كيفية عمل نسخة احتياطية من السجل واستعادته انقر فوق رقم المقالة التالي لعرضها في "قاعدة المعارف لـ Microsoft:
322756كيفية عمل نسخة احتياطية و استعادة التسجيل في Windows

اتبع الخطوات التالية لتمكين الخيار IP_TOS للدالة setsockopt Winsock الخيار - v للحصول على الأداة المساعدة ping على Windows 2000 أو Windows XP أو Windows Server 2003:
  1. بدء تشغيل "محرر التسجيل" (Regedt32.exe).
  2. انتقل إلى المفتاح التالي:
    H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\TcpIp\Parameters
  3. إذا كنت تقوم بتشغيل Windows 2000 اتبع الخطوات التالية:
    1. من القائمة تحرير ، انقر فوق إضافة قيمة.
    2. في المربع اسم القيمة ، اكتب DisableUserTOSSetting.
    3. في القائمة نوع البيانات انقر فوق REG_DWORD ثم انقر فوق موافق.
    4. في مربع البيانات، اكتب قيمة 0 (صفر) ومن ثم انقر فوق موافق.
    إذا كنت تقوم بتشغيل Windows XP أو Windows Server 2003، اتبع الخطوات التالية:
    1. من القائمة تحرير ، أشر إلى جديد ثم انقر فوق قيمة DWORD.
    2. اكتب DisableUserTOSSetting كاسم إدخال ثم ثم اضغط ENTER.

      عند إضافة هذا الإدخال يتم تعيين القيمة إلى 0 (صفر). لا تقم بتغيير القيمة.
  4. قم بإنهاء "محرر التسجيل" ، ثم قم بإعادة تشغيل جهاز الكمبيوتر.
لمزيد من المعلومات حول استخدام التطبيق جودة الخدمة (QoS) "واجهات برمجة التطبيقات" (API) والذي قد بفاعلية استبدال الخيار IP_ToS راجع MSDN على إنترنت والبحث عن QoS.

لمزيد من المعلومات حول حركة مرور الأولويات انقر فوق أرقام المقالات التالية لعرضها في "قاعدة المعارف لـ Microsoft:
222102الأولويات حركة المرور باستخدام الأسبقية IP
222020وصف إشارات P 802.1
233039QoS التقنيات قائمة الانتظار
لمزيد من المعلومات حول إدخال التسجيل DisableUserTOSSetting في Windows Server 2003، قم بزيارة موقع Microsoft التالي على الويب:

تحذير: تمت ترجمة هذه المقالة تلقائيًا

خصائص

رقم الموضوع: 248611 - آخر مراجعة: 02/28/2007 00:54:20 - المراجعة: 3.6

Microsoft Windows Server 2003, Standard Edition (32-bit x86), Microsoft Windows Server 2003, Enterprise Edition (32-bit x86), Microsoft Windows Server 2003, Web Edition, Microsoft Windows XP Professional, Microsoft Windows XP Home Edition, Microsoft Windows 2000 Server, Microsoft Windows 2000 Advanced Server, Microsoft Windows 2000 Professional Edition, Microsoft Windows NT Server 4.0 Standard Edition, Microsoft Windows NT 4.0 Service Pack 5, Microsoft Windows NT Workstation 4.0 Developer Edition, Microsoft Windows NT Workstation 4.0

  • kbmt kbinfo kbnetwork KB248611 KbMtar
تعليقات
did=1&t=">ync=""> var varAutoFirePV = 1; var varClickTracking = 1; var varCustomerTracking = 1; var Route = "76500"; var Ctrl = ""; document.write(" >